1 Ejemplo de la base de datos de la empresa necesitamos crear un diseño de esquema de base de datos basado en los siguientes requisitos (simplificados) de la base de datos de la empresa: la empresa está organizada en los departamentos. Cada departamento tiene un nombre, número y un empleado que administra el departamento. Hacemos un seguimiento de la fecha de inicio del gerente del departamento. Un departamento puede tener varias ubicaciones. Cada departamento controla una serie de proyectos. Cada proyecto tiene un nombre único, un número único y se encuentra en una sola ubicación.
2 Base de datos de la empresa de ejemplo (cont.) Almacenamos el número de seguro social de cada empleado, la dirección, el salario, el sexo y la fecha de nacimiento. Cada empleado trabaja para un departamento, pero podemos trabajar en varios proyectos. Continuamos la cantidad de horas por semana que una semana y que una semana es que un Actualmente, el empleado trabaja en cada proyecto. También realizamos un seguimiento del supervisor directo de cada empleado. Cada empleado puede tener una serie de dependientes. Para cada dependiente, realizamos un seguimiento de su nombre, sexo, fecha de nacimiento y relación con el empleado.
3 Conceptos del modelo de relación entre entidades (ER) Un popular modelo de datos conceptuales de alto nivel y atributos Las centros de las centros son objetos específicos o cosas en el mini mundo que están representados en la base de datos. Por ejemplo, el empleado John Smith, el departamento de investigación, el Proyecto ProductX segra son propiedades utilizadas para describir una entidad. Por ejemplo, una entidad de empleado puede tener el nombre de los atributos, SSN, dirección, sexo y entidad específica de biocato tendrá un valor para cada uno de sus atributos. Por ejemplo, una entidad de empleado específica puede tener nombre = ‘John Smith ‘, ssn =’ ‘, dirección =’ 731, Fondren, Houston, TX ‘, Sex =’ M ‘, BirthDate = ’09 -Jan-55’El Attribute tiene un conjunto de valor (o tipo de datos) asociado con él- p.ej. entero, cadena, subrangule, tipo enumerado,…
4 Figura 7.1 El diagrama de esquema conceptual ER para la base de datos de la empresa.
¿Qué es una base de datos y 5 ejemplos?
Existen numerosos programas de contabilidad, impuestos y administrativos. Cada uno de estos programas recopila los datos ingresados en una base de datos. Sobre la base de los datos almacenados, se imprimen las facturas y los recordatorios, se crean los formularios y se completan digitalmente, se generan análisis y se gestionan las cuentas de crédito y crédito.
Los sistemas de gestión de la tierra son utilizados por grandes empresas y tiendas en línea (por ejemplo, Amazon), así como a empresas más pequeñas (por ejemplo, un taller de automóviles). Todos los datos de artículos de una acción de ventas se registran y se administran en bases de datos. Los Super Markets se pueden mencionar como un ejemplo. El artículo es reconocido allí por el proceso de escaneo en la caja registradora y se observa en consecuencia en el sistema. El inventario actual de los elementos se puede llamar en cualquier momento.
Los sistemas ERP forman la interfaz entre diferentes sistemas de bases de datos y, a veces, también actúan como sus propios sistemas. Las bases de datos de diferentes sistemas deben poder comunicarse entre sí. Se realiza un intercambio de datos utilizando sistemas ERP. Los diferentes recourcs luego hablan completamente autosuficiente en segundo plano sin que un usuario tenga que intervenir directamente.
Los sistemas de gestión de contenido se utilizan para administrar fácilmente los sitios web. El usuario no necesita ningún conocimiento de programación. Después de instalar el CMS en el servidor web, el sistema ofrece una superficie virtual tanto para el cliente como para aquellos que mantienen las páginas (administrador). Con sus datos de acceso, el administrador se registra en un backend de SO y puede administrar completamente la página. Además del contenido de las páginas, esto también incluye la representación óptica y el diseño.
Los sistemas CRM siempre se usan cuando la relación de una empresa con sus clientes debe ser presentada y administrada. Un buen ejemplo es una asociación de clubes que aborda los clubes como clientes, por un lado, y por otro lado, las personas individuales que son miembros de los clubes. Con un sistema CRM, todos los datos y funciones de los clubes se pueden registrar y administrar. Los miembros están asignados tanto a las asociaciones como a cualquier relación directa con los clientes con la asociación, por ejemplo, participando en cursos pagados.
¿Dónde se utilizan las bases de datos Ejemplos?
Con una base de datos en línea personalizable, las organizaciones se posicionan para la optimización de costos y una mejor competitividad. Por supuesto, el equipo de Kohezion cree que el software de base de datos en línea es la mejor herramienta para crear aplicaciones de bases de datos. Los usuarios no técnicos que necesitan manejar datos importantes, como si fueran expertos, pueden usar fácilmente Kohezion. Este producto combina todos los profesionales de los productos de base de datos clásicos con la facilidad de uso de una hoja de cálculo de Excel para ofrecerle una solución altamente personalizable y fácil de implementar. Sin embargo, los usuarios deben buscar otros ejemplos de la aplicación de la base de datos para tomar la decisión correcta para su negocio.
Cuando se trata de bases de datos, es fácil perderse en las muchas definiciones. Si las palabras como SQL, consultas, tablas y registros hacen que su cabeza gire, estoy aquí para ayudarlo a resolverlo todo. Para poder comprender mejor qué es Kohezion y cómo crear aplicaciones de bases de datos, realicemos primero otros tres ejemplos de la aplicación de la base de datos: sistemas de gestión de bases de datos basados en SQL, sistemas de administración de bases de datos NOSQL/NewsQL y hojas de cálculo de Excel. Primero, explicaré qué es una base de datos. Luego, exploraré cuáles son los principales tipos de bases de datos y lenguajes de bases de datos disponibles, incluidos los pros y los contras para cada uno de ellos, y ejemplos de cómo se pueden usar. Concluiré esta publicación explicando qué es Kohezion y cómo encaja en el mundo de las bases de datos.
En su expresión más simple, una base de datos es una recopilación de información, aquí llamada Data, almacenada en un servidor. Organiza los datos de una manera para que el usuario final pueda recuperarlos, administrarlos y editarlos de manera significativa. Estos datos podrían ser algo muy simple, como la información personal sobre clientes o clientes. También podría ser inventario, ventas, llamadas o cualquier cosa que cualquiera necesite rastrear. Depende del usuario determinar el formato y los datos que necesitan para agregar.
Cuando usa una base de datos, no almacena los datos en el disco duro de su computadora, sino en la nube de un servidor, en algún lugar. Utilizando un sistema de gestión de bases de datos (DBMS), realiza llamadas/consultas para recuperar la información; esto se llama back-end. Para presentar los datos de una manera consecuente al usuario, los desarrolladores web crean un sitio web y aplicaciones de bases de datos fáciles de usar. Esta parte se llama front-end.
Incluso si hay muchos otros modelos de bases de datos, como modelos jerárquicos y de red, el modelo de base de datos relacional es el más común. El modelo de base de datos relacional se desarrolló a principios de la década de 1970 y sigue siendo el modelo más común hasta el día de hoy. Usted almacena los datos en las relaciones, tomando la forma de tablas hechas de columnas (campos) y filas (registros/elementos). Para acceder e interactuar con los datos contenidos en una base de datos relacional, su usuario necesita usar un sistema de gestión de bases de datos relacionales (RDBMS). Aunque hay otros ejemplos de aplicaciones de bases de datos, el lenguaje más común utilizado para consultar y administrar bases de datos relacionales es SQL (lenguaje de consulta estructurado).
¿Cómo hacer una base de datos ejemplo?
Resumen: en este tutorial, aprenderá cómo crear una nueva base de datos en SQL Server utilizando la instrucción Crear base de datos o SQL Server Management Studio.
La instrucción Crear base de datos crea una nueva base de datos. A continuación se muestra la sintaxis mínima de la declaración Crear base de datos:
En esta sintaxis, especifica el nombre de la base de datos después de la palabra clave Crear base de datos.
El nombre de la base de datos debe ser único dentro de una instancia de SQL Server. También debe cumplir con las reglas del identificador del servidor SQL. Por lo general, el nombre de la base de datos tiene un máximo de 128 caracteres.
La siguiente declaración crea una nueva base de datos llamada TestDB:
Lenguaje de código: SQL (lenguaje de consulta estructurada) (SQL)
Una vez que la declaración se ejecuta correctamente, puede ver la base de datos recién creada en el explorador de objetos. Si la nueva base de datos no aparece, puede hacer clic en el botón Actualizar o presionar el teclado F5 para actualizar la lista de objetos.
Esta declaración enumera todas las bases de datos en el servidor SQL:
O puede ejecutar el procedimiento almacenado sp_databases:
Primero, haga clic con el botón derecho en la base de datos y elija nueva base de datos… elemento del menú.
En segundo lugar, ingrese el nombre de la base de datos, por ejemplo, SampleDB y haga clic en el botón Aceptar.
Tercero, vea la base de datos recién creada desde el explorador de objetos:
En este tutorial, ha aprendido cómo crear una nueva base de datos utilizando la instrucción de base de datos SQL Server Crear y SQL Server Management Studio.
¿Cuáles son ejemplos de bases de datos?
La forma más simple de bases de datos es una base de datos de texto. Cuando los datos se organizan en un archivo de texto en filas y columnas, se puede usar para almacenar, organizar, proteger y recuperar datos. Guardar una lista de nombres en un archivo, comenzando con el primer nombre y seguido por el apellido, sería una base de datos simple. Cada fila del archivo representa un registro. Puede actualizar los registros cambiando los nombres específicos, puede eliminar filas eliminando líneas y puede agregar nuevas filas agregando nuevas líneas.
Los programas de base de datos de escritorio son otro tipo de base de datos que es más compleja que una base de datos de texto pero destinado a un solo usuario. Una hoja de cálculo de Microsoft Excel o Microsoft Access son buenos ejemplos de programas de bases de datos de escritorio. Estos programas permiten a los usuarios ingresar datos, almacenarlos, protegerlos y recuperarlos cuando sea necesario. El beneficio de los programas de bases de datos de escritorio a través de bases de datos de texto es la velocidad de cambiar los datos y la capacidad de almacenar grandes cantidades de datos mientras mantiene manejable el rendimiento del sistema.
Las bases de datos relacionales son los sistemas de bases de datos más comunes. Incluyen bases de datos como SQL Server, Oracle Database, Sybase, Informix y MySQL. Los sistemas de gestión de bases de datos relacionales (RDMS) cuentan con un rendimiento mucho mejor para administrar datos en programas de bases de datos de escritorio. Por ejemplo, permiten que múltiples usuarios (¡incluso miles!) Trabajen con los datos al mismo tiempo, creando seguridad avanzada para el acceso a los datos. Los sistemas RDBMS almacenan datos en columnas y filas, que a su vez compensan tablas. Una tabla en RDBMS es como una hoja de cálculo. Un conjunto de tablas constituye un esquema. Varios esquemas crean una base de datos. Se pueden crear muchas bases de datos en un solo servidor.
Las estructuras más innovadoras para almacenar datos hoy en día son las bases de datos NOSQL y orientadas a objetos. Estos no siguen el enfoque de tabla/fila/columna de RDBMS. En cambio, construyen estanterías de elementos y permiten acceso por estantería. Entonces, en lugar de rastrear palabras individuales en libros, NoSQL y las bases de datos orientadas a objetos reducen los datos que está buscando al señalarlo a la estantería, luego un asistente mecánico trabaja con los libros para identificar la palabra exacta que está buscando. NoSQL intenta específicamente simplificar las estanterías almacenando datos de manera desnormalizada; Esto significa almacenarlo en grandes trozos.
¿Cuáles son los ejemplos de base de datos?
¿Cuáles son los DBMS más utilizados (sistema de gestión de bases de datos)? ¿Qué tipo de base de datos se usa en empresas italianas? A menudo, a menudo se les hace preguntas al mundo de las bases de datos o que están tratando de comprender cuál es la solución para elegir. Entonces, veamos los 10 motores de base de datos más populares según la clasificación de DB-Engines, que utilizan los modelos de datos y cuánto se otorgó la cuota de mercado italiana en 2019.
En primer lugar, en orden de popularidad, encontramos el motor relacional Oracle del mismo nombre, que utiliza la extensión de SQL llamado PL/SQL (lenguaje de procedimiento/lenguaje de consulta estructurada). Según Datanyze, Oracle gana el 6.67% de la cuota de mercado en Italia con su base de datos relacional, pero varios productos de la compañía están presentes en el mercado que no fluyen en este porcentaje.
Es una base de datos relacional de código abierto muy popular, basada en el lenguaje SQL ANSI. Ha sido propiedad de Oracle Corporation desde 2010. MySQL tiene el 36.76% de la participación de mercado de nuestro país y es el segundo motor de base de datos más popular del mundo.
La primera base de datos de los diez principales de popularidad está orientada a documentos y utiliza un modelo de desarrollo de código abierto. El propietario MongoDB Inc. ofrece soporte y servicios pagados adicionales. En Italia gana el 3.06% de la participación de mercado el año pasado.
Este es el motor de búsqueda más popular entre las empresas, propiedad de elastic y distribuido con un modelo mixto de código abierto y licencias patentadas. En Italia se coloca con el 4.11% de la cuota de mercado en los motores de búsqueda.
¿Qué bases de datos existen y cuáles son las más utilizadas?
No sorprende que Oracle esté constantemente en la parte superior de las listas de bases de datos populares. La primera versión de esta herramienta de administración de bases de datos se creó a fines de los años 70, y hay una serie de ediciones de esta herramienta disponibles para satisfacer las necesidades de su organización.
La versión más reciente de Oracle, 12C, está diseñada para la nube y se puede alojar en un solo servidor o servidores múltiples, y permite la administración de bases de datos que tienen miles de millones de registros. Algunas de las características de la última versión de Oracle incluyen un marco de cuadrícula y el uso de estructuras físicas y lógicas.
Esto significa que la gestión de datos físicos no tiene efecto en el acceso a estructuras lógicas. Además, la seguridad en este lanzamiento es excelente porque cada transacción está aislada de otros.
- Encontrará las últimas innovaciones y características provenientes de sus productos, ya que Oracle tiende a establecer la barra para otras herramientas de gestión de bases de datos.
- Las herramientas de administración de bases de datos de Oracle también son increíblemente robustas, y puede encontrar una que pueda hacer casi cualquier cosa que pueda pensar.
- El costo de Oracle puede ser prohibitivo, especialmente para organizaciones más pequeñas.
- El sistema puede requerir recursos significativos una vez instalados, por lo que se pueden requerir actualizaciones de hardware para implementar Oracle.
Ideal para: grandes organizaciones que manejan enormes bases de datos y necesitan una variedad de características.
MySQL es una de las bases de datos más populares para aplicaciones basadas en la web. Es Freeware, pero con frecuencia se actualiza con características y mejoras de seguridad. También hay una variedad de ediciones pagas diseñadas para uso comercial. Con la versión Freeware, existe un mayor enfoque en la velocidad y la confiabilidad en lugar de incluir una amplia gama de características, que puede ser buena o mala dependiendo de lo que intente hacer.
¿Cuál es la base de datos en una empresa?
Una base de datos en informática recopila los datos (recopilar) y los conecta a una unidad lógica. Los datos individuales se proporcionan en forma de metadescripciones y acompañados por toda la información para su procesamiento.
Si un DB es racional y de manera eficiente, es posible significar el significado de todos los datos registrados. Cuanto más se optimice un archivo, más es posible integrar más herramientas de extracción y análisis, informes, inteligencia, ETL (carga de transformación de extracción). Se trata de organizar el proceso de extracción, transformación y carga de datos. Que incluye su organización y centralización en un solo repositorio.
El proceso ETL pone a disposición estos datos extrayendo de un número ilimitado de fuentes. También realiza su limpieza para transformarlos y finalizarlos al negocio, integrando datos a través de sistemas heterogéneos.
Idealmente, la operación es similar a la de un archivo digital avanzado. Una base de datos crea una estructura que le permite insertar y modificar rápidamente la información deseada. Una vez almacenado en una computadora electrónica, este conjunto de datos puede ser interrogado por cualquier terminal, utilizando claves de acceso a cargo.
Así es como, gracias a la DB, la información no se pierde. Una vez almacenados, pueden ser manejados y tratados para ser utilizados en las áreas de aplicación más dispares.
Desde un punto de vista arquitectónico, se incorpora una base de datos en un hardware (físico o en la nube) y se alimenta y se cuestiona con el software.
¿Cuál es la mejor base de datos para una empresa?
Esto significa más que solo hardware confiable. Para disfrutar del beneficio completo de una base de datos, se requiere la mejor plataforma de base de datos, es si una empresa administra su base de datos interna, la alberga fuera del sitio o incluso la administra a través de un servicio de terceros.
Hay muchas opciones de software de base de datos diferentes para elegir. Muchas pequeñas empresas carecen de la infraestructura de TI para dedicar mucho tiempo a investigar la mejor plataforma de base de datos de negocios.
Hicimos el trabajo duro por ti. En este artículo, explicamos las cinco mejores plataformas de bases de datos comerciales. También brindamos asesoramiento experto para que pueda elegir la mejor plataforma de base de datos para su negocio, incluidos consejos y consejos de propietarios de pequeñas empresas como usted.
Debido a que no hay dos empresas exactamente las mismas, una plataforma de base de datos debe ser perfectamente adecuada para las necesidades de la pequeña empresa. Antes de decirle nuestras selecciones para las mejores plataformas de base de datos disponibles, comencemos con algunos consejos de dueños de negocios experimentados que pasaron por el proceso de elegir la mejor plataforma de base de datos para su empresa.
Lianne Sanders es instructora de yoga y editora de contenido en Total Shape. Ella también administra una pequeña clase de negocios de yoga. Al principio, estaba abrumada por todas las opciones que encontró al comprar una plataforma de base de datos para sus muchas empresas. Para administrarlo todo, ella rompió el proceso en pequeños pasos.
El primer paso, dice, es considerar exactamente lo que necesita hacer su plataforma y ajustar las expectativas en consecuencia. Hacerlo puede requerir aportes del equipo, continúa, así que comience preguntándose a sí mismo y a su equipo cómo se deben organizar los datos, así como exactamente cómo se debe almacenar la información y qué medidas de seguridad deben establecerse.
Artículos Relacionados:
